Golf Car Repair: Common Issues That Require Attention
Golf cars are a popular mode of transportation in resorts, communities, and on golf courses. However, like any vehicle, they can experience common issues that affect their performance and safety. Identifying these problems early on is crucial to prevent further damage and ensure the user’s safety. Some of the common issues that require repair include worn-out tires, faulty brakes, electrical system malfunctions, and more.
Tire Wear and Tear
Tire wear is a significant concern for golf cars, as it can lead to reduced traction, uneven ride quality, and decreased overall performance. Worn-out tires can cause the golf cart to veer off course or experience sudden loss of control, posing a risk to the users. Common indicators of tire wear include:
- Cracks or cuts on the tire surface
- Uneven tire wear patterns, such as bald spots or excessive wear on the center tread
- Increased vibrations or wobbling while driving
Brake Faults
Faulty brakes can be a serious safety concern, as they can cause the golf cart to stop suddenly or fail to stop altogether. Common brake-related issues include worn-out brake pads, uneven brake wear, or malfunctioning brake fluid circulation. Some warning signs of brake faults include:
- Squealing or grinding noises while applying brakes
- Soft or mushy brake pedal
- Increased stopping distance or difficulty stopping
Electrical System Issues
The electrical system of a golf cart is responsible for powering essential systems, including the lights, horn, and motor. Common electrical-related issues include faulty wiring, broken switches, or dead batteries. Some warning signs of electrical system malfunctions include:
- Interior or exterior lights that fail to turn on or flicker
- Dead battery or slow-starting issues
- Mysterious malfunctions, such as erratic horn beeping or flickering headlights
Common Issues and Their Impact on Golf Carts
The following table summarizes some common issues with golf carts, their impact on the user, and estimated repair costs.
| Part/Golf Cart System | Common Issues | Impact on User | Estimated Repair Cost |
|---|---|---|---|
| Tires | Worn-out or damaged tires, tire imbalance | Reduced traction, uneven ride quality, and decreased overall performance | $50-$200 per tire, depending on type and size |
| Brakes | Worn-out brake pads, uneven brake wear, or malfunctioning brake fluid circulation | Sudden stops, loss of control, or failure to stop altogether | $100-$500, depending on the extent of damage and required replacement parts |
| Electrical System | Faulty wiring, broken switches, or dead batteries | Malfunctioning lights, horn, or motor; dead battery or slow-starting issues | $100-$500, depending on the extent of damage and required replacement parts |
| Motor and Transmission | Clogged filters, faulty solenoids, or worn-out gears | Reduced engine performance, slow acceleration, or difficulty shifting gears | $200-$1,000, depending on the extent of damage and required replacement parts |
These common issues can significantly affect the overall performance and safety of a golf cart. Identifying and addressing these problems early on can prevent further damage, ensure the user’s safety, and extend the lifespan of the vehicle. Always inspect your golf cart regularly and address any concerns with a qualified repair technician to maintain its optimal condition.

Benefits and Limitations of DIY Repairs
While DIY golf cart repairs can be cost-effective and satisfying, they also come with several limitations:
- Without proper training and experience, you may end up causing more damage to the vehicle.
- You may not have access to specialized tools or equipment.
- DIY repairs may void your warranty, if your golf cart is still under warranty.
- You may not have the time or patience to perform the repairs.
Before deciding to tackle a DIY repair, make sure you weigh the pros and cons and consider your level of expertise and experience.

Safety Protocols for High-Voltage Electrical Systems
When working with high-voltage electrical systems, safety protocols must be followed to prevent injury or death. Some safety protocols include:
- Wearing personal protective equipment (PPE) such as insulation gloves and safety glasses
- Disconnecting power to the electrical system before performing repairs
- Using lockout/tagout procedures to prevent accidental start-up of the electrical system
- Following proper lifting and handling techniques to avoid injury
Safety Protocols for Hazardous Materials
When working with hazardous materials, safety protocols must be followed to prevent exposure or contamination. Some safety protocols include:
- Wearing personal protective equipment (PPE) such as respirators and protective suits
- Handling materials in a well-ventilated area with proper containment procedures
- Following proper disposal procedures for hazardous materials
- Reading and following the manufacturer’s safety data sheet (SDS) for the material being handled

Hazards to Consider
When it comes to golf car repairs, several hazardous materials are often used, including lead-acid batteries, paint strippers, and solvents. These materials can cause environmental damage if not disposed of properly.
- We’ll discuss the risks associated with each of these materials and explore ways to minimize their impact.
- Lead-acid batteries, for example, contain toxic lead that can contaminate soil and water if not disposed of correctly.
- Paint strippers can release volatile organic compounds (VOCs) into the air, contributing to air pollution.
- Solvents, on the other hand, can contaminate soil and groundwater if not handled and disposed of properly.
To mitigate these risks, it’s crucial to have a plan in place for environmentally responsible disposal of hazardous materials.
